Preston Park
Preston Park forms part of central Brighton, positioned just north of the city centre around its famous Victorian park. The area connects easily via the A23 London Road, the main route from the M23 and London, whilst the A270 and A259 provide coastal access. With over 350 EV charging points nearby and Preston Park station offering direct London services, it's well-connected for both local and long-distance travel. The area's centrepiece remains its 63-acre park, home to Britain's oldest cycling track at Preston Park Velodrome, built in 1877.
